Using multiple systems for high availability
When configuring multiple LDD systems, you can connect them to a hardware load balancer or Global Site Selector
(GSS) to provide high availability, without using clustering, as well as increased capacity.

Each system group contains two identical LDD systems. Jobs are balanced between these systems in each group by the
hardware load balancer or GSS. If a failure occurs in one system in a group, then the other system in the group receives
all incoming jobs until the failed system can be restored.
